I need to construct a 'townsperson' costume for my 4yold wee girl's nativity play. I'm quite handy with a needle and have a lightweight sewing machine so can manage most things. (Also have my mum and sis here this weekend so some more advanced help). But I'd like to do more than just a teatowel - any ideas/blogs/websites.

Help me clever crafters!

Oh my DD is townsperson! IS your DDs play in a traditional style? If so, we have been given a sort of loose faktan type thing in a dirty pink colour...its cotton, long and has long sleeves which are quite loose and baggy.

She has a green sash thing around her waist aand that's that!

You could go for a log skirt with a plain white long sleeved blouse and an apron?
